The Main Street blog is preoccupied with the bungalow and shot gun houses of Rocky Mount. When I came across a Southernliving.org article on a Tiny House in a craftsman style, I was immediately charmed.

“In the embrace of simplicity and a homage to artisanal craftsmanship, the concept of the Craftsman tiny home comes alive with a twist of modernity and a nod to the past. The inspiration behind this abode is a blend of the timeless beauty of the Arts and Crafts movement and the efficiency and sustainability of contemporary tiny living.” Holly Owens-Contributing Writer (The photos had no attribution)
